Key Sump Pump Checks: Keep Water Out, Keep Peace of Mind

A functioning sump pump is your first line of protection against water damage. However, even the most reliable pumps need routine maintenance to keep them in top condition. Neglecting your sump pump can lead to a range of issues, from small leaks to extensive flooding.

Prevent these headaches by following a few simple maintenance steps: periodically check the pump's float switch and make sure it's operating properly. Check the pump's discharge line for clogs. Eliminate any debris and ensure that water is draining freely away from your home.

It's also important to test your sump pump regularly to ensure it's ready to handle unexpected heavy rainfall or weather events. You can do this by directly activating the pump and observing its operation.

By taking these precautions, you can confirm that your sump pump is ready to protect your home from water damage, providing you with peace of mind.

Ensure the Life of Your Sump Pump: Expert Maintenance

Sump pumps are essential|form the backbone of your basement's protection sump pump installation against water damage. To keep these hardworking machines functioning optimally, regular care is crucial. Start by examining the pump and its parts at least once a month. Look for indicators of wear and tear, such as rust to the impeller or housing.

Clean the basin regularly to prevent clogs that can hinder the pump's efficiency. Run your sump pump monthly by simulating a flood. Make sure it operates promptly and effectively removes water. If you notice any problems, don't hesitate to call a qualified plumber for service. By following these simple tips, you can extend the life of your sump pump and keep your home safe from water damage.
